WINNIPEG — Manitoba’s police watchdog says a Mountie did not use too much force during an arrest where a woman suffered a broken arm in Beausejour. The Independent Investigation Unit says an RCMP officer responded to a call in April about a woman throwing items in a convenience store. As the officer struggled with the intoxicated woman her right arm was broken. The woman has no memory of what happened and she was admitted for a mental health assessment. The unit, which investigates all serious incidents involving police in Manitoba, says the Mountie will not face charges.
